The opening match and opening ceremony for the first-ever co-hosted women’s tournament will take place on 20 July 2023 at New Zealand’s Eden Park in Auckland/Tāmaki Makaurau. Stadium Australia in Sydney/Gadigal has been selected to host the final a month later on 20 August. , Jul 17, 2566 BE ... According to the WSJ, Fifa was targeting US$300 million. The FIFA U-17 Women's World Cup is a biennial international women's association football tournament for female players under the age of 17. It is organized by Fédération Internationale de Football Association ( FIFA) since 2008. The current champions are Spain, who won its second title at the 2022 edition in India ., The Women's World Cup is the premier competition for women's soccer, held every four years and hosted by different nations across the globe. Play as any of the stars of the FIFA Women’s World Cup™ You can immerse yourself in the FIFA Women's World Cup™ as you take control of any star player from the 32 qualified national teams., 2 days ago · He scored a total of 16 goals across four World Cup tournaments, from 2002 through 2014. Marta, playing for the Brazilian women’s national team, scored her 17th World Cup goal during the 2019 Women’s World Cup, becoming the top scorer across the men’s and women’s tournaments. She played in five World Cups, from 2003 through 2019. , 2 days ago · He scored a total of 16 goals across four World Cup tournaments, from 2002 through 2014.
